
merhaba arkadaşlar bu yazımızda sizlerle bir uygulama altında metin şifreleme,şifre çözme,metni ters çevirme ve güvenlik kodu oluşturma kodlarını paylaşacağım.
fazla uzatmadan kodları paylaşayım sizlerle.
ayrıca cs sayfasına yazılan kodlar ana forma çağıracağız.
bunla ile ilgili bilgisi olmayan varsa yorumda belirtsin. bun içinde bir yazı yazalım.
———————Sifreler.cs—————————
public string tersCevirme(string gelen) { string isim = ""; for (int i = gelen.Length - 1; i >= 0; i--) { isim += gelen[i]; } return isim; } public string Sifre(string gelen) { string sfr = ""; foreach (char x in gelen) { int ascii = (int)x + 3; sfr += (char)ascii; } return sfr;//muhendisarsivi.com } public string Sifrecoz(string gelen) { string sfr = ""; foreach (char x in gelen) { int ascii = (int)x - 3; sfr += (char)ascii; } return sfr; } public String guvenlik() { string harfler = "qweryuıopüasdfghjklşi,1a2s3d4f6h7l8ğ9u_?Q=ER)(U/O&%+^'!0"; Random rnd = new Random();//muhendisarsivi.com string gkod = ""; for (int i = 0; i < 5; i++) { gkod += harfler[rnd.Next(harfler.Length)]; } return gkod; } //muhendisarsivi.com
——————-Form1.cs——————-
private void ekranayaz(string gelen) { MessageBox.Show(gelen); } private void button1_Click(object sender, EventArgs e) { Sifreler sfr = new Sifreler(); if (comboBox1.SelectedIndex == 0) { textBox2.Text = sfr.tersCevirme(textBox1.Text); }//muhendisarsivi.com else if (comboBox1.SelectedIndex == 1) { textBox2.Text = sfr.Sifre(textBox1.Text); } else if (comboBox1.SelectedIndex == 2) { textBox2.Text = sfr.Sifrecoz(textBox2.Text); } else if (comboBox1.SelectedIndex == 3) { textBox2.Text = sfr.guvenlik();//muhendisarsivi.com } else ekranayaz("seçimyapınız..."); }
Ekran resmi
indirme linki burda